Nio is a leading electric vehicle maker, targeting the premium segment. Founded in November 2014, Nio designs, develops, jointly manufactures, and sells premium smart electric vehicles. The company differentiates itself through continuous technological breakthroughs and innovations, such as battery swapping and autonomous driving. Nio launched its first model, its ES8 seven-seater electric SUV, in December 2017, and began deliveries in June 2018. Its current model portfolio includes midsize to large sedans and SUVs. It sold around 326,000 EVs in 2025, accounting for about 2% of China's passenger new energy vehicle market.
Gildan is a vertically integrated designer and manufacturer of basic apparel, including T-shirts, underwear, socks, and hosiery. It is a leader in blank T-shirts, sweatshirts, and other apparel to wholesalers, major clothing brands, and printers (printwear). Gildan also sells branded clothing through retail and direct-to-consumer channels, a business that has been greatly enhanced by the Hanesbrands acquisition. Gildan's brands include Hanes, Bali, Maidenform, Playtex, Gildan, American Apparel, Comfort Colors, and Goldtoe. Gildan produces most of its clothing at factories in Latin America but has been ramping up production at its new facility in Bangladesh. Incorporated in 1984, the Montreal-based company operates internationally but generated 90% of its sales in the US in 2025.
